#a69181 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a69181 is composed of 65.1% red, 56.9%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 22.3%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 25.9 degrees, a saturation of 17.2% and a lightness of 57.8%. #a69181 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d2303.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#a69181 color description : Dark grayish orange.
#a69181 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a69181 has RGB values of R:166, G:145,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.22,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10916225.

Shades and Tints of #a69181
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a69181
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959392 is the less saturated color, while #f9862e is the most saturated one.
